Studies on serological cross-reaction of Neospora caninum with Toxoplasma gondii and Hammondia heydorni.

The en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) was used to examine cross-reactivity of Neospora caninum with Toxoplasma gondii and Hammondia heydorni. Anti-T. gondii mouse and cat sera cross-reacted with N. caninum soluble antigen (NLA), but not with the recombinant surface antigen (NcSRS2). Differential detection of Hammondia hammondi from Toxoplasma gondii using polymerase chain reaction.

Hammondia hammondi and Toxoplasma gondii are two related coccidian parasites, with cats as definitive hosts and warm-blooded animals as intermediate hosts. It is difficult to differentiate them by morphological and serological parameters. Molecular detection of Neospora caninum from naturally infected dogs in Lorestan province, West of Iran

Neospora caninum is a coccidian protozoan that causes abortion in dairy and beef cattle and neurological disorders in dogs and horses. To identify N. caninum oocysts in the dog feces the molecular approaches are known as sensitive methods that specifically detect the oocysts.
